   1#ifndef _LINUX_SHM_H_
   2#define _LINUX_SHM_H_
   3
   4#include <asm/page.h>
   5#include <uapi/linux/shm.h>
   6
   7#define SHMALL (SHMMAX/PAGE_SIZE*(SHMMNI/16)) /* max shm system wide (pages) */
   8#include <asm/shmparam.h>
   9struct shmid_kernel /* private to the kernel */
  10{       
  11        struct kern_ipc_perm    shm_perm;
  12        struct file *           shm_file;
  13        unsigned long           shm_nattch;
  14        unsigned long           shm_segsz;
  15        time_t                  shm_atim;
  16        time_t                  shm_dtim;
  17        time_t                  shm_ctim;
  18        pid_t                   shm_cprid;
  19        pid_t                   shm_lprid;
  20        struct user_struct      *mlock_user;
  21
  22        /* The task created the shm object.  NULL if the task is dead. */
  23        struct task_struct      *shm_creator;
  24};
  25
  26/* shm_mode upper byte flags */
  27#define SHM_DEST        01000   /* segment will be destroyed on last detach */
  28#define SHM_LOCKED      02000   /* segment will not be swapped */
  29#define SHM_HUGETLB     04000   /* segment will use huge TLB pages */
  30#define SHM_NORESERVE   010000  /* don't check for reservations */
  31
  32/* Bits [26:31] are reserved */
  33
  34/*
  35 * When SHM_HUGETLB is set bits [26:31] encode the log2 of the huge page size.
  36 * This gives us 6 bits, which is enough until someone invents 128 bit address
  37 * spaces.
  38 *
  39 * Assume these are all power of twos.
  40 * When 0 use the default page size.
  41 */
  42#define SHM_HUGE_SHIFT  26
  43#define SHM_HUGE_MASK   0x3f
  44#define SHM_HUGE_2MB    (21 << SHM_HUGE_SHIFT)
  45#define SHM_HUGE_1GB    (30 << SHM_HUGE_SHIFT)
  46
  47#ifdef CONFIG_SYSVIPC
  48long do_shmat(int shmid, char __user *shmaddr, int shmflg, unsigned long *addr,
  49              unsigned long shmlba);
  50extern int is_file_shm_hugepages(struct file *file);
  51extern void exit_shm(struct task_struct *task);
  52#else
  53static inline long do_shmat(int shmid, char __user *shmaddr,
  54                            int shmflg, unsigned long *addr,
  55                            unsigned long shmlba)
  56{
  57        return -ENOSYS;
  58}
  59static inline int is_file_shm_hugepages(struct file *file)
  60{
  61        return 0;
  62}
  63static inline void exit_shm(struct task_struct *task)
  64{
  65}
  66#endif
  67
  68#endif /* _LINUX_SHM_H_ */
